== Function Summary ==
* **Entrez Summary**: N/A
* **UniProt Summary**: Proton-conducting pore forming subunit of the membrane integral V0 complex of vacuolar ATPase. V-ATPase is responsible for acidifying a variety of intracellular compartments in eukaryotic cells.
